    HOW WILL YOUR ROLE IMPACT FIRST COMMAND?

     

    Serve First Command’s high net worth clients by partnering with Advisors and FP Advanced Planning Consultants to identify candidates for customized portfolio management (IMA).  Construct and manage risk appropriate portfolios in conjunction with client’s financial plan as prepared by Advisor. Constructs and manages investment portfolios for high net worth clients ($500k minimum) and communicates with clients and Advisors about portfolio performance, allocation and position changes, and market events that influence portfolio behavior.  Represents First Command’s highest level of investment expertise and client service.
